Exercise
$\left(x-1\right)^4\cdot\left(x^2-2x\right)$
Step-by-step Solution
Learn how to solve special products problems step by step online. Expand the expression (x-1)^4(x^2-2x). Expand the binomial \left(x-1\right)^4. Multiply the single term x^2-2x by each term of the polynomial \left(x^4-4x^3+6x^2-4x+1\right). Multiply the single term x^4 by each term of the polynomial \left(x^2-2x\right). When multiplying exponents with same base we can add the exponents.
Expand the expression (x-1)^4(x^2-2x)
Final answer to the exercise
$x^{6}-6x^{5}+14x^{4}-16x^{3}+9x^2-2x$
